Five people from Bihar, including two kids, were killed and seven seriously injured when the bus in which they were travelling collided with a dumper on the Lucknow-Faizabad highway early this morning.
The Volvo bus was on its way to Muzaffarpur in Bihar from Delhi's Anand Vihar inter-state bus terminus (ISBT). It hit the dumper while crossing the road near Safedabad town, around 25km from Lucknow, said the superintendent of police (SP), Virendra Srivastava.
The deceased have been identified as Mukesh Kumar (22), Ankita Yadav (18), Suraj Panapur Saroj (15), Israr Ali (1) and Shagufta (5), the SP said, adding that all of them belonged to Bihar.
The injured were admitted to the district hospital. Two seriously injured were rushed to Lucknow Trauma Centre, he added.
